What A Dedicated Developer Means
A dedicated Laravel developer is a developer assigned full-time or near full-time to your project, usually working as an extension of your team. This model is different from a one-off freelancer because you get continuity, deeper product understanding, and faster iteration.
For urgent hiring, this model is useful when you need:
A backend fix or feature release.
An MVP built quickly.
A replacement developer for an existing Laravel codebase.
Ongoing support for an active product.

Step-By-Step Hiring Process
1. Define the project clearly
Write a short brief with:
Project goal.
Current stack and Laravel version if known.
Required skills, such as REST APIs, Blade, Livewire, Nova, queues, testing, or MySQL.
Timeline, budget range, and timezone preference.
A clear brief reduces back-and-forth and helps you move fast.
2. Choose the right hiring source
Common options include:
Specialist Laravel agencies.
Vetted developer marketplaces.
Freelance platforms.
Internal referrals.
For urgent hiring, vetted marketplaces and agencies are usually faster than open job boards because the talent is already screened.
3. Screen for core skills
Ask for:
Laravel portfolio or GitHub work.
Experience with authentication, queues, caching, and APIs.
Database design ability.
Test coverage habits.
Deployment experience.
4. Run a short technical interview
Keep it focused on real work. Ask how they would:
Debug a slow endpoint.
Structure a feature in Laravel.
Secure user input.
Handle background jobs.
Estimate a small task.
5. Start with a paid test task
A 2 to 4 hour task reveals more than a long interview. Good test tasks include:
Fixing a bug.
Building one API endpoint.
Writing a simple integration test.
Reviewing an existing controller for improvements.
6. Close with onboarding
Share:
Repository access.
Deployment instructions.
Style guides.
Milestones.
Communication rules.
Fast onboarding is what turns a 24-hour hire into a useful hire.

What skills should a Laravel developer have?
They should understand Laravel architecture, APIs, databases, authentication, testing, queues, and deployment.
Should I hire a freelancer or a dedicated developer?
Hire a freelancer for small, isolated tasks. Hire a dedicated developer for ongoing product work, faster iteration, and continuity.
How do I test a developer quickly?
Use a short paid task, such as fixing a bug or creating one API endpoint, instead of relying only on interviews.
What is the biggest mistake when hiring fast?
Rushing past vetting. A fast hire without code review or a test task can cost more later.
